Fantastic people, great food with a wide selection. I've been coming here for years, since it was called "Workers Cafe". The food has always been really high quality - it's one of those great examples of multicultural London: traditional greasy spoon breakfasts along with kebabs, Mediterranean omelettes and roasts - and a great range of desserts. When it gets busy you might have to wave to get their attention, but that's ok - it's great to see a place like this being so busy. I've never been disappointed with a meal and never had bad service - in fact it's the opposite. Even when they're busy, they give me attention. Sometimes people aren't very tolerant of how much pressure staff can be under in fast-moving cafes - retail is hard work any day of the week, food service is even harder. Give them a smile and enjoy your meal :-)
